The Two Assessments That Determine Your Child's Foreseeable future
When it comes to personal university admissions, there are specifically two IQ assessments that make any difference:
The WPPSI-IV (Wechsler Preschool and Primary Scale of Intelligence – Fourth Edition) for ages 4 years to 7 decades, seven months.
The WISC-V (Wechsler Intelligence Scale for Children – Fifth Edition) for ages 6 many years to 16 several years, eleven months.

Why These Exams Are Your Child's Ticket to Elite Schooling
Here is what most dad and mom Will not fully grasp: These assessments Really don't just evaluate intelligence. They supply a comprehensive cognitive profile that reveals your child's distinctive strengths and Understanding design.
The WPPSI-IV measures five critical areas that expose your son or daughter's cognitive strengths: verbal comprehension demonstrates how properly they recognize and use language, visual spatial talents exhibit their talent for examining Visible data and solving spatial problems, fluid reasoning reveals their sensible imagining techniques, Doing work memory signifies their capacity to carry and manipulate details mentally, and processing speed steps how speedily they're able to complete psychological duties properly.
The WISC-V addresses comparable floor but with age-acceptable complexity, examining verbal comprehension for language competencies and verbal reasoning, visual spatial processing and Visible-motor coordination, fluid reasoning for abstract thinking and challenge-solving, Doing the job memory for consideration and concentration, and processing pace for mental effectiveness.
